Job Title: Senior DXP Developer
Location: New Haven, CT (Hybrid schedule- open to remote for the right candidate in tri-state)
Duration: Contract to hire

Overview
The Senior DXP developer will develop solutions requiring analysis and research, working on small to large complex projects that requires increased skill of the Optimizely platform. Analyzes, codes, tests, documents and supports the web applications that are developed and maintained within ITS and interfacing with outside vendors. Performs design work. The DXP Developer will collaborate with our UI/UX team, mentor junior staff and foster a collaborative environment.

Core Responsibilities
  • Participate actively in sprint planning, backlog refinement, and daily standups.
  • Work independently on user stories and implementation tasks, ensuring timely completion and quality.
  • Develop and maintain unit and integration tests to support robust software deployment.
  • Investigate and address performance issues, technical challenges, and operational problems.
  • Draft and update technical documentation to ensure clarity and continuity.
  • Manage task-level communications, promptly reporting delays or blockers to ensure project timelines are met.
  • Triage defects effectively and develop fixes to maintain software integrity and user satisfaction.
  • Provide detailed code walkthroughs to the lead developer or system architect, demonstrating thorough understanding and implementation of requirements.
  • Demonstrate completed work to key stakeholders and internal audiences, highlighting functionality and aligning with OneMember program goals.
Skills Qualifications
  • Expert-level knowledge of Optimizely CMS.
  • A solid understanding and experience of standard DevOps tooling and processes.
  • High-level knowledge of Git and the standard development workflows.
  • Solid knowledge of JavaScript and JavaScript frameworks such as React/Angular etc.
  • Strong understanding of the SDLC and agile software development principals
  • Proven experience with Optimizely's platform and its customization, with depth in the CMS product.
  • Strong proficiency in Microsoft .NET development.
  • Experience writing and maintaining unit and integration tests.
  • Excellent problem-solving skills and ability to research optimal solutions.
  • Strong communication skills, capable of effectively articulating technical challenges and solutions to team members and stakeholders.
  • Ability to work independently and adapt to new challenges and environments.
  • Ability to prioritize and successfully manage multiple initiatives.
